Osaka, Japan, July 30, 2026 – Today, GPTRACK50, an independent studio founded by veteran action game developers, brings a tonne of fantastic news about their upcoming action-RPG Stupid Never Dies. First, the team revealed an October 21, 2026, global release date on PlayStation®5 and PC. Additionally, GPTRACK50 announced that they have entered into a co-publishing agreement with SEGA who will be responsible for the game’s worldwide publishing and distribution.

Players can purchase the game as a Standard Edition for $49.99 USD. Those who want the full post-apocalyptic pop-punk experience can also purchase the Stupid Never Dies: Glorious Idiot Edition for $59.99, which includes the full game alongside its first DLC, TickTock Teddies: Nonsense Overload Pack.
Containing five original TickTock Teddies that add a slew of bonkers visual features and new remixes for the game’s background music to keep your monster-fueled dungeon dives fresh and exciting, the TickTock Teddies: Nonsense Overload Pack DLC includes:
DLC Original TickTock Teddy #1: Big Head: Includes: Big Head Effect + New Combat Music Track Remix. Who said an underdog can’t have an ego? Use this effect to give Davy an oversized bobblehead, while triggering an exclusive composition version of the combat music.
DLC Original TickTock Teddy #2: Chirp Chirp: Includes Footstep Sound Effect + New Home Music Track Remix. Put an extra spring in Davy’s step with a cheerfully unique footstep sound effect while Davy is in Zombie Style, while listening to a fresh new background track as you prep for battle.
DLC Original TickTock Teddy #3: Festival: Includes Hit Sound Effect (during Davy Burst) + Davy Burst Background Music Track Remix. Make an impact as Davy decimates monsters on your way to KOM with new hit sound effects and a new remix of the background music during Davy Burst.

DLC Original TickTock Teddy #4: Romantic: Includes New Effects for Davy Burst + Main Theme Replaces Davy Burst Background Music. Add a little extra style to Davy Burst as the graffiti-style effects are replaced with an exciting new special gimmick, adding the game’s theme song in place of the original Davy Burst background music.
DLC Original TickTock Teddy #5: Splash: Includes Level-Up Effects + “Hurry Up” Music Track Remix. Davy gains new level-up effects to make sure monsters know that his power has grown, as a new remix of the “Hurry Up” background music plays.

About Stupid Never Dies
Developed by GPTRACK50, a new studio formed by veteran action game developers, Stupid Never Dies delivers a single-player 3D action RPG experience unlike anything you’ve played before.
Set in a monster-ruled otherworldly dungeon, Stupid Never Dies puts you in control of Davy, a timid zombie living at the very bottom of monster society. Defeat enemies, level up, and collect strange items to grow stronger on your quest to bring Julia, a frozen human girl, back to life.
Steal enemy abilities, customize your undead body with bizarre upgrades, and experience fast-paced combat packed with innovation.

Stupid Never Dies will be available for PC via Steam and PlayStation 5 on October 21, 2026, followed by a Japan release on October 22. The game will be available for purchase as a Standard Edition for $49.99 USD, or as part of the Stupid Never Dies: Glorious Idiot Edition for $59.99 USD.
The game will be available in English, with English, French, German, Italian, Spanish, Japanese, Korean, Russian, Polish, Latin American Spanish, Brazilian Portuguese, Traditional Chinese, and Simplified Chinese as supported subtitle languages.

About GPTRACK50
GPTRACK50 Inc. was established in Osaka, Japan, in October 2022 by President Hiroyuki Kobayashi with the mission of creating new entertainment IPs, primarily through the development of consumer video games for a global audience. The company aims to expand its original IPs beyond games, exploring cross-media opportunities such as live-action films, animation, and more.
The major past works of our staff include the Devil May Cry series, the DRAGON’S DOGMA series, the Resident Evil series, and more.
